What are some typical challenges faced when designing an evening menu for a restaurant?

Designing an evening menu often involves balancing creativity with practical constraints such as ingredient availability, kitchen workflow, and guest preferences. You may face challenges like accommodating dietary restrictions, ensuring dishes are profitable, and differentiating the menu from competitors while maintaining consistency. Collaboration with chefs, kitchen staff, and management is crucial to ensure the menu is both appealing and operationally feasible. Staying updated on food trends and guest feedback can also guide adjustments for continual improvement.

What is evening menu design?

Evening menu design refers to the creation and arrangement of menus that are specifically tailored for dinner service at restaurants, hotels, or catering events. This process involves selecting suitable dishes, organizing the menu layout, and considering factors like cuisine, pricing, customer preferences, and seasonal ingredients. A well-designed evening menu not only enhances the dining experience but also helps boost sales and establish a restaurant’s brand identity. Menu designers work closely with chefs and managers to ensure the menu is visually appealing and operationally efficient.

The first-ever full-service restaurant inside a Crate and Barrel store, the Table at Crate is a modern, casual restaurant featuring Bill Kim's morning-to-evening menu full of clever twists. The Table at Crate brings together the things we love best-connecting people, creative food and timeless design. 


Bartender Responsibilities

  • Greet guests, accurately take food and drink orders, and enter them into the point of sale system. 
  • Recognize intoxicated guests, refuse to over-serve guests, and seek out management with any concerns about a guest that appears intoxicated.
  • Account for and maintain the security of all bar stock and inventory.
  • Prepare and serve beverages to guests according to recipes. 
  • Stock/restock appropriate areas of the bar with alcohol, glassware, ice, and supplies.
  • Accurately record and account for all items ordered, process payments, and balance all sales/receipts in compliance with restaurant policies and procedures.
  • Make a constant effort to tailor service and add personalization.
  • Participate in daily service meetings.
  • Take ownership of your designated station.
  • Maintain a comprehensive knowledge of menu items.
  • Articulately describe all menu items, including daily additions to the menu.
  • Assist other stations whenever necessary.
  • Assist in training new bar staff.
  • Always recommend beverages to the guests in an up-selling manner and answers any questions.
  • Monitor guests to fulfill additional requests.
  • Communicate any difficulties, guest comments, and other relevant information to your manager.
